For isolating specific eigenvector-eigenvalue pairs, Parlett champions the Rayleigh Quotient Iteration. RQI delivers cubic convergence, meaning the number of correct digits triples with each iteration, provided the initial guess is close enough to the target eigenvector. 4. While the original 1980 edition is hard to find, published a Classics in Applied Mathematics edition of The Symmetric Eigenvalue Problem. This version remains the authoritative source, often available in university libraries, via online academic databases, or as an official ebook.
